2858668
0xf7aeb6ffd4eab8378300aa6faa8b1ec46e1784fa5a7c1f49a6a3e73f76f1b585
Transactions0
Height2858668
Confirmations13244294
Timestamp1112 days 15 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d34004ecef0aa872
Bits
Difficulty0xd20fb17